National ICT Adviser

 

The Partnership for Inclusive Prosperity / Parseria ba Prosperidade Inklusivu (PROSIVU) Program is seeking a National ICT Adviser to build the capacity of staff within the CSC ICT Development Unit in the development of a new in-house personnel management system (SIGAP).

The National ICT Adviser will report to the chief of unit of the ICT development unit and coordinate with the Executive Secretary who is responsible for the overall activities of the SCSC. 

The Adviser will also work closely with the International ICT Adviser and others within the ICT Development Unit. The Adviser will work with the Pillar Lead and chief of unit to develop a clear workplan detailing activities, expected results, timeframes, and responsibilities. The workplan will outline the gradual transfer of skills and responsibilities to CSC staff and will be used to monitor progress and outcomes. 

PROSIVU is an Australian Government program supported by DT Global. PROSIVU is the next phase of Australia’s governance support to Timor-Leste. The program will extend Australia’s longstanding partnership with Timor-Leste in support of good governance and economic policy development. It is Australia’s primary program for providing support to Timor-Leste’s central government agencies and economic line-ministries. 

This is a locally engaged position. The National ICT Adviser will have the following qualifications, experience, and skills:

 

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s Degree in ICT, Computer Science, Engineering, or related field. 
  • Relevant post-graduate qualifications would be highly regarded.

Essential experience and knowledge

  • At least five years’ experience in a professional ICT role, at least three years of which should be in ICT systems development using PHP.
  • Experience in ICT systems development in a government setting would be highly regarded.
  • Experience in Public Administration area would be highly regarded.
  • Previous experience in system development using open-source tools would be highly regarded.
  • Previous experience in project management would be highly regarded.

Skills

  • Skills in ICT programming using multiple language including PHP and SQL database management systems such as SQL Server, MySQL and PostgreSQL
  • Skills in SQL database, system development, design and administration. 
  • Strong interpersonal skills, including ability to liaise with Government officials and CSC counterparts.
  • Skills and experience in training and knowledge transfer would be well regarded.
  • A high level of proficiency and English and Tetun are required. Portuguese language skills would be an advantage.
